Beshar Dentistry, we encounter serious consequences of smokeless tobacco use because many occur in the mouth. Oral cancer, mouth lesions, gum disease and tooth decay are the most common dental problems caused by smokeless tobacco in NYC. Keeping a pinch between your cheek and gum all day is worse than keeping an all-day sucker. The tobacco contains almost as much sugar as the candy but delivers harmful chemicals as an added bonus.

The dangers are two-fold: the tobacco erodes the teeth and also causes the gums to pull away from teeth. If smokeless tobacco use is stopped, the lesions often disappear within a year for NYC dental patients. Oral Cancer in NYC : Smokeless tobacco use in NYC increases the risk for several types of life-threatening cancers including those of the mouth, gums, lips, tongue, and throat. Oral cancers can be as deadly as lung cancer and usually require surgery.

This includes menthol-flavored products and allows only tobacco-flavored vaping products to be sold. Retailers are prohibited from accepting or honoring discounts, including the use of coupons or multipack price promotions.

As of May , Public Health Law Article F Section MM-2 , pharmacies or retail establishments that contain a pharmacy may no longer sell tobacco and vaping products. As of July 1, , Public Health Law Article F Section DD-1 restricts the public display of tobacco and vaping product advertisements and the display of smoking paraphernalia within feet of school in New York City and within 1, feet of a school in the rest of the state.

In , the law was amended to restrict the shipment of vapor products to only registered vapor product dealers, export warehouse owners, or agents of the state or federal government in accordance with official duties. This amendment ends the shipment of online orders of vapor products to individual consumers, a primary way underage youth purchased vaping products. Postal Service.

These state and federal laws work together to curtail the sale of cigarettes, other tobacco products, and e-cigarettes over the internet and require internet sellers to affix tax stamps and pay all federal, state, local or Tribal tobacco taxes. Penalties include increased monetary fines and registration suspensions and revocations. Retailers cannot sell cigarettes, cigars, chewing tobacco, powdered tobacco, shisha or other tobacco products, herbal cigarettes, liquid nicotine, electronic cigarettes, rolling papers, or smoking paraphernalia to people under 21 years of age.

Penalties for illegal sales to minors include fines, loss of license to sell lottery tickets, and loss of registration to sell tobacco and vapor products. Every registered tobacco retailer is assessed annually for compliance with this law.

NYS has one of the highest state cigarette taxes in the country. Localities may levy additional tobacco taxes with the approval of the state legislature. The tax is paid for by the person buying the product. The vapor product dealer is responsible for collecting the tax and paying and reporting it to the Department of Tax and Finance.

Every retail dealer of cigarettes or tobacco products in NYS and every owner or operator of vending machines that sell cigarettes or tobacco products must register with the Department of Taxation and Finance.
